Core Viewpoint - Chinese universities, particularly Tsinghua University, have surpassed Harvard and other top U.S. institutions in AI patent competition, indicating a significant shift in global technological leadership [2][5]. Group 1: Historical Context - In 1999, the gap between Chinese and U.S. researchers was substantial, with many top talents leaving China for opportunities abroad [6][9]. - Zhang Yaqin's return to China marked a pivotal moment as he aimed to build a world-class research institute, which has since achieved significant milestones in AI and technology [7][10]. Group 2: Technological Advancements - Over the past 25 years, China's technological landscape has transformed, with the country becoming a global leader in various tech sectors, including AI [9][17]. - The establishment of Microsoft Research Asia (MSRA) played a crucial role in showcasing China's R&D capabilities, leading to increased investment from multinational companies [11][13]. Group 3: Current Developments - As of 2025, Tsinghua University's AI research institute is focused on practical applications of AI, emphasizing collaboration between technology and industry [17][19]. - The institute has produced numerous research outcomes and is committed to open-source initiatives, contrasting with the proprietary nature of past corporate research [18][19]. Group 4: Future Outlook - Zhang Yaqin expresses optimism about the future of AI in China, highlighting the importance of balancing innovation with governance to address potential risks [19][20]. - The ongoing evolution of AI technology necessitates global cooperation to manage its implications effectively [19].
